Released in November 2024, this is the first single-barrel release from Eric LeGrand Whiskey, founded by LeGrand, a former Rutgers football player who was paralyzed from the neck down during a game. LeGrand is donating $5.20 from every case of bourbon he sells to the Christopher and Dana Reeve Foundation, which works to find a cure for paralysis. Eric LeGrand Bourbon is sourced from Green River in Owensboro, Kentucky. This expression is bottled at 52% ABV and costs $62.99.

  • Nose:

    Fruit-forward, sweet, balanced and delectable nose. A big orange peel note is joined by peaches and cream, graham cracker, cinnamon, cherry and marshmallow fluff.

  • Taste:

    Apple pie leads the palate, joined by peanut brittle, oak, tannin, pretzel, orange peel and crème brûlée.

  • Finish:

    Warming finish with plenty of oak and tannin, plus crisp apple, cinnamon, brown sugar and banana nut muffins.

  • Overall:

    This is a dynamite single barrel. Well done, Green River and Eric LeGrand. Delicious bourbon.
